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Mount Carmel

** The Mazda repair market in Mount Carmel, IL, is characterized by a handful of highly capable general auto repair shops rather than dedicated Mazda specialists. The absence of a nearby Mazda dealership (the closest are in Evansville, IN, or Vincennes, IN) means these local shops are the primary resource for owners. The average quality is quite high, with several long-standing businesses enjoying excellent reputations for honesty and technical competence. Competition is moderate but reputation-driven, leading to strong customer service. For standard maintenance (oil changes, brakes) on mainstream Mazda models like the CX-5 or Mazda3, pricing is competitive and in line with regional averages. However, for the specialized services you've listed—particularly rotary engine work or advanced transmission/AWD diagnostics—the scope is limited. These jobs would likely require consultation with the shop to confirm capability, and pricing may be higher due to the specialized knowledge and diagnostic time required. For absolute certainty on complex issues, owners often make the ~60-mile trip to the Mazda dealer in Evansville, but for the vast majority of repairs and maintenance, the local Mount Carmel shops are more than capable.

When should I seek local service for a Mazda-specific warning light, like the check engine light?

Seek service immediately if the light is flashing, indicating a severe issue. For a steady light, schedule a diagnostic at a trusted local shop promptly. Delaying can lead to more costly repairs, especially before longer drives on rural Illinois highways where roadside assistance may have longer response times.
